Connect Hermes (alpha)
Guide (informative) · For: operators · Prereqs: Quickstart
Hermes (Nous Research) joins a Cotal mesh as a lateral peer, with the
same shared cotal_* tool surface and delivery model as the other connectors. The hermes
connector ships in the cotal-ai package, so no extra install of the connector itself.
Alpha means it runs today (spawn it, it joins the mesh and takes turns) but with real
constraints, all verified below: it is Unix-only, needs an external Python toolchain you
provide (uv + hermes-agent on a pinned version line), is not offered in the cotal setup
picker, is not bundled in the container image (so no containerized Hermes, see
Deploy), and does not support session resume.
Prerequisites
Section titled “Prerequisites”- Unix (macOS or Linux). Windows is unsupported; the connector throws at launch (it uses an AF_UNIX socket bridge and a Python sidecar).
uvon your PATH. The launcher runsuv run --project <connector> hermes gateway run, souvprovisions the Python environment that provides thehermesCLI.hermes-agenton the pinned0.16line. The launcher asserts the installed version at startup and fails loudly on a mismatch (no silent degrade), because a different major.minor can move the plugin/platform/hook API this connector targets.
Spawn it
Section titled “Spawn it”cotal spawn --agent hermes # foreground in this terminalCOTAL_DEFAULT_AGENT=hermes cotal spawn # make it the default harness (an explicit --agent wins)Or set agent: hermes in a team manifest. Persona and role come from the agent
file like any connector (see agent-files.md).
Hermes is not in the cotal setup picker (setup wires only Claude Code and OpenCode), so it
is spawn-only: there is no setup step for it beyond having the toolchain above.
Choose a model
Section titled “Choose a model”Hermes is model-agnostic; set any one provider’s key in your environment. Model precedence
matches the other connectors: the --model flag, else the agent file’s model:, else an ambient
HERMES_MODEL. Hermes exposes no cotal models catalog (unlike OpenCode).
How it binds
Section titled “How it binds”Unlike Claude Code or OpenCode (where the harness is the process), Hermes runs as a long-lived
gateway daemon that spins up a fresh agent per inbound message. So the mesh connection can’t
live inside a per-turn process; the connector’s command is a small launcher/supervisor that
owns the mesh endpoint for the gateway’s whole life and runs hermes gateway run as its child.
- The launcher bridges to an in-gateway Python plugin (the platform adapter, presence hooks,
and the
cotal_*tools) over local AF_UNIX sockets. - It runs the gateway in an isolated
HERMES_HOMEprofile (a temp dir), so your own~/.hermesis never touched, with approvals off (a supervised agent has no human at the TUI to approve). - The persona is written as Hermes’
SOUL.md(its system-prompt file), the one place a system prompt can be set.
The shared tool surface and inbound-message model are documented once, for all connectors: see mcp-tools.md and connect-claude.md.
Limits
Section titled “Limits”- Unix-only (no Windows).
- No session resume:
cotal spawn --resumethrows. - Not containerized: the deploy image bundles only Claude Code and OpenCode (no
uv/hermes-agent), so there is no containerized Hermes today. - Brings its own toolchain: you supply
uvand ahermes-agenton the pinned line.
